61. What is Gaganyaan and what are its key objectives for India's space program?
Gaganyaan is India's crewed orbital spacecraft mission, undertaken by ISRO, with the primary objective of sending humans to space. It aims to demonstrate India's capability to send humans to low Earth orbit (LEO) and contribute to scientific research and technological advancements.

2. What are the key provisions of the Gaganyaan mission?
The key provisions of the Gaganyaan mission include:
- •Sending a crew of 3 astronauts to an orbit of 400 km for 5-7 days.
- •The spacecraft will consist of a crew module (where astronauts live) and a service module (containing essential equipment).
- •The launch vehicle will be the GSLV Mk III.
- •Development of critical technologies such as life support systems, crew escape system, and re-entry technologies.

3. How does the Gaganyaan mission work in practice?
In practice, the Gaganyaan mission involves the integrated effort of various systems. The GSLV Mk III will launch the spacecraft into LEO. The crew module will house the astronauts, while the service module provides essential support. Critical technologies like life support and re-entry systems ensure the safety and success of the mission. Extensive training and uncrewed test flights are crucial before the actual crewed mission.

4. What are the challenges in the implementation of the Gaganyaan mission?
Challenges in implementing the Gaganyaan mission include:
- •Development of critical technologies like life support systems and re-entry technologies.
- •Ensuring the safety and well-being of the astronauts during the mission.
- •Meeting the strict timelines and budget constraints.
- •Coordinating various agencies and departments involved in the mission.
